she utilizes

Grammar usage guide and real-world examples

US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"she utilizes"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when describing how someone makes use of a particular resource, tool, or method in a specific context. Example: "In her research, she utilizes various statistical methods to analyze the data effectively."

Expert writing Tips

Best practice

Consider substituting "she utilizes" with more specific verbs that convey the precise action being taken, such as "employs", "applies", or "implements", to enhance clarity and conciseness.

Common error

Avoid using "utilizes" in overly informal or casual writing. In these situations, "uses" is often a more natural and appropriate choice. Overusing "utilizes" can make your writing sound stilted or pretentious.

FAQs

What are some alternatives to "she utilizes" that I can use in my writing?

Depending on the context, you can use alternatives like "she employs", "she makes use of", or "she applies".

Is there a difference between "she uses" and "she utilizes"?

"Utilizes" often implies a more strategic or deliberate use of something, while "uses" is a more general term. The choice depends on the specific nuance you want to convey.

When is it appropriate to use "she utilizes" in academic writing?

It's appropriate to use "she utilizes" in academic writing when you want to emphasize that a person is making strategic and effective use of specific methods, resources, or techniques in their research or analysis. It's a good fit when describing methodologies or approaches.

Can "she utilizes" be used in all types of writing, or are there contexts where it's less suitable?

While grammatically correct, "she utilizes" is less suitable for casual or informal writing. In those contexts, a simpler term like "she uses" or "she applies" would be more appropriate.
